Dear Ms. Shai:

One of the things Fiverr recommends is that you use Social Media to publicize your gigs. That’s also why they offer Fiverr Anywhere, which you can access under the link: Selling >> Promote Your Business.

I took a look at your gig. Here are my thoughts:

  • Your log line:
    This is fine.

*Your profile image:

You’re not smilng here, but you’re smiling in your video cover. I’d suggest you find another photo in which you are smiling.

  • Your profile text:

This seems fine to me.

  • Gig Title:

One thing to bear in mind when creating gig titles is that you want key words to make it stand out. The only key words in this title are “text,” “guys,” and “girls.” I have no idea what key words would make this stand out, but I suggest you find some.

One thing to bear in mind is that many people just will not read your gig description. You’ll need to deal with people who just order, who don’t realize what you’re offering.

A suggested format for your gig descriptions:

WHO I AM

WHAT YOU GET

WHY YOU SHOULD BUY FROM ME

RECOMMENDED GIG EXTRAS

  • Video: 30 to 60 seconds. Your video is very brief. I’d recommend that you re-shoot this video, going for widescreen aspect ratio. Spend more time explaining just what you’re offering.

Gig Images: You have 1. You should have 3. Maybe show sample conversations?

Gig Extras: I suggest you brainstorm on some other ideas for gig extras.

I’m not your target audience, and I don’t understand this gig, so I can’t really offer specific advice about it, other than to say that I think you would really help yourself by offering a separate gig with your e-book in which you describe what you do.

It doesn’t need to be a long book, but you could use the book to position yourself as an expert in your field of helping people talk to each other.

You could use lots of screen shots of these kinds of conversations, showing how what you do helps the buyer.

A lot of people fear that if they give away these kinds of tricks and tips in a book, it will make people need them less, but information marketers claim that having a book like this will bring you new customers.

Plus, if you can offer a $5 book, it takes you only seconds to deliver it. You can show your book cover with you as the author on your website, Twitter, Facebook, and so on, which helps to build your brand as an expert. You can use your book as your calling card.

Also, this gig seems to be two gigs in 1:

  1. you teach people how to own the conversation
  2. you compose texts for them to use

You might want to consider splitting these gigs – part 1 seems to be very time consuming, as you could almost write a book about it!
